<span style="font-family: Comic Sans MS"><span style="font-size: medium">It has come to my attention that <span class="squiggly" title="To see spelling suggestions, click this word" splc="splc" state="new" word="Hobico">Hobico</span> has been shipping <span class="squiggly" title="To see spelling suggestions, click this word" splc="splc" state="new" word="TT">TT</span> 40 Pro engines with 46 crank, piston, sleeve, and heads.
The case says it's a 40 as well as the box but they are not. This might not be a big deal to you unless you are racing in AMA 424 or Club 40 class.
The first tip off is if a quarter will fit between the head and case you may have a 46.
The stroke and bore are about <span class="squiggly" title="To see spelling suggestions, click this word" splc="splc" state="new" word="1mm">1mm</span> larger on the 46.
If you have one please call <span class="squiggly" title="To see spelling suggestions, click this word" splc="splc" state="new" word="Hobico">Hobico</span> and let them know it.
These will likely be engines purchased with in the last year...</span></span>
